Chandigarh: The Punjab Government led by Chief Minister Bhagwant Mann remains dedicated to considering and addressing every legitimate demand of state employees, stated Cabinet Minister for Industries and Commerce Aman Arora. Describing the three crore residents of Punjab and government employees as part of one shared family, the Minister noted that the administration seeks to resolve outstanding issues through constructive dialogue, mutual understanding, and a positive approach.
Addressing employee concerns, the Minister affirmed that substantial steps have already been taken to improve working conditions and benefits. The administration has implemented a decision to provide 60% Dearness Allowance for approximately 85,000 employees recruited after July 17, 2020, bringing their rates on par with the Central Government scale.
Regarding broader DA and arrears matters, the Minister maintained that the government respects the judicial process as the issue remains before the Supreme Court, while keeping administrative channels open for open discussions.
Appealing to employee organizations to call off the ongoing strike and resume public service, the Minister asserted that governance works best when officers and administration operate on the same side. The primary objective of the leadership remains ensuring seamless public administration without causing unnecessary hardship to citizens, with doors staying open to find a constructive way forward together.
